The Role
As a Senior Civil / Infrastructure Engineer, you will be involved in the design and delivery of a wide range of infrastructure projects from initial concept through to detailed design and construction support. Key responsibilities include:
- Producing highway, drainage and infrastructure designs to current industry standards.
- Preparing 2D and 3D highway alignments and infrastructure layouts using Civil 3D and AutoCAD.
- Developing drainage strategies and SuDS designs.
- Managing and commissioning surveys, technical studies and reports.
- Leading smaller projects, ensuring delivery to programme and budget.
- Providing technical guidance and mentoring to Graduates, Engineers and Technicians.
- Liaising with clients, local authorities and other project stakeholders.
- Supporting the wider team in identifying follow-on work and new project opportunities.
You will also work closely with transport planning and water engineering specialists on larger multidisciplinary developments.
About You
To be considered for this role, you should have experience working within a consultancy environment and be confident delivering infrastructure design projects with minimal supervision. Ideally, you will have:
- A BEng/BSc in Civil Engineering or a related discipline.
- Experience in the civil/infrastructure design field.
- Strong working knowledge of Civil 3D and AutoCAD.
- Experience designing highways, drainage and SuDS schemes.
- Good understanding of DMRB, Manual for Streets, Section 38, Section 278, Section 104 and the Code for Adoption.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- A proactive and collaborative approach to project delivery.
- Chartered or Incorporated ICE status, or be actively working towards professional accreditation.
